After Ohio State clinched the national championship against Notre Dame in January, photos of Buckeyes players savoring victory cigars swept across the internet. Among the celebrations, one cigar made its mark—literally—by burning a hole in an official College Football Playoff Ohio State team chair. This uniquely marked chair is now among the intriguing items up for grabs in a special auction hosted by LC Events/Buckeye Cruise for Cancer, running through Saturday night.
For collectors and fans, the silent auction offers some remarkable memorabilia, including that infamous chair with the cigar burn. Bidding online is open until 9:45 p.m. on Saturday.
Other enticing items in the silent auction lineup include a CFP team chair signed by Jeremiah Smith, a national champions edition record player, an Emeka Egbuka autographed football, and two Authentic Game-Worn Rose Bowl jerseys signed by JT Tuimoloau and Donovan Jackson. Rounding out the range is an autographed helmet from Caleb Downs.
Meanwhile, the live auction, featured at the "Saddle Up at the Woody" event, promises even more exclusive treasures. Highlights include a 2025 national championship ring, autographed jerseys, a game-worn OSU helmet from the national championship signed by Ryan Day, the eye-catching Goodyear Tire OSU Helmet Sculpture, a VIP trip to the 2025 Wisconsin game, and an OSU-themed Black Diamond Cruiser Golf Cart.
